Registry data for most common operations is managed automatically.
Other operations can require an administrator to create, remove, or modify
registry data.

An object and a tag are created by HCL
VersionVault when
you create a VOB or a view. The tag and the object are removed when you remove
a VOB or a view. In many cases, no further administrative action is required.
You might need to manipulate VOB and view objects and tags for
any of the following reasons:
To make a tag available in another registry region
To change the name of a VOB or view
After you move a VOB or view to a different host
After you restore a VOB or view from backup media
To clean up the registry after a VOB or view is removed by a nonstandard
procedure
To inspect, create, and repair VOB and view objects and tags,
use the VersionVault Registry node
of the HCL
VersionVault Administration
Console or any of the cleartool subcommands named in How cleartool commands affect registry data, which shows how these
